Octodad: Dadliest Catch will be getting co-op gameplay

Young Horses‘ Kevin Geisier has clarified that the #update has added “multiple mouse support” to the local co-op feature. “Previously, you needed #controllers on PC for additional players,” he said, “but it now accepts multiple USB mice, trackpads.”

Multiplayer co-op is coming to Octodad: Dadliest Catch, and the title is currently 50% off on Steam.

An update published yesterday confirms that the patch also brings two new Shorts – “Dad Romance” and “Medical Mess” – as well as a story-mode timer, new temporary checkpoints and a host of other improvement and stability tweaks.

Developer Young Horses detailed in the patch notes that “multiple mice support for co-op” will also be rolled out, suggesting that co-op may initially be restricted to local multiplayer for now. To clarify this, we’ve reached out to Young Horses on the multiplayer feature and will update you as soon as we know more.

The patch is live and available now. For more, check out Octodad: Dadliest Catch‘s Steam Community page.
